DeployedStatefulServiceReplicaDetailInfo
Informatie over een stateful replica die wordt uitgevoerd in een codepakket. Opmerking DeployedServiceReplicaQueryResult bevat dubbele gegevens, zoals ServiceKind, ServiceName, PartitionId en replicaId.
Eigenschappen
Naam | Type | Vereist |
---|---|---|
ServiceName |
tekenreeks | No |
PartitionId |
tekenreeks (uuid) | Nee |
CurrentServiceOperation |
tekenreeks (opsomming) | Nee |
CurrentServiceOperationStartTimeUtc |
tekenreeks (datum-tijd) | Nee |
ReportedLoad |
matrix van LoadMetricReportInfo | Nee |
ReplicaId |
tekenreeks | No |
CurrentReplicatorOperation |
tekenreeks (opsomming) | Nee |
ReadStatus |
tekenreeks (opsomming) | Nee |
WriteStatus |
tekenreeks (opsomming) | Nee |
ReplicatorStatus |
ReplicatorStatus | Nee |
ReplicaStatus |
KeyValueStoreReplicaStatus | Nee |
DeployedServiceReplicaQueryResult |
DeployedStatefulServiceReplicaInfo | Nee |
ServiceName
Type: tekenreeks
Vereist: Nee
Volledige hiërarchische naam van de service in URI-indeling die begint met fabric:
.
PartitionId
Type: tekenreeks (uuid)
Vereist: Nee
Een interne id die door Service Fabric wordt gebruikt om een partitie uniek te identificeren. Dit is een willekeurig gegenereerde GUID toen de service werd gemaakt. De partitie-id is uniek en verandert niet gedurende de levensduur van de service. Als dezelfde service wordt verwijderd en opnieuw is gemaakt, zijn de id's van de partities anders.
CurrentServiceOperation
Type: tekenreeks (opsomming)
Vereist: Nee
Hiermee geeft u de huidige actieve levenscyclusbewerking op een stateful servicereplica of stateless service-exemplaar op.
Mogelijke waarden zijn:
-
Unknown
- Gereserveerd voor toekomstig gebruik. -
None
- De servicereplica of het exemplaar ondergaat geen wijzigingen in de levenscyclus. -
Open
- De servicereplica of het exemplaar wordt geopend. -
ChangeRole
- De servicereplica verandert rollen. -
Close
- De servicereplica of het exemplaar wordt gesloten. -
Abort
- De servicereplica of het exemplaar wordt afgebroken.
CurrentServiceOperationStartTimeUtc
Type: tekenreeks (datum-tijd)
Vereist: Nee
De begintijd van de huidige servicebewerking in UTC-indeling.
ReportedLoad
Type: matrix van LoadMetricReportInfo
Vereist: Nee
Lijst met belasting gerapporteerd door replica.
ReplicaId
Type: tekenreeks
Vereist: Nee
Id van een stateful servicereplica. ReplicaId wordt door Service Fabric gebruikt om een replica van een partitie op unieke wijze te identificeren. Het is uniek binnen een partitie en verandert niet voor de levensduur van de replica. Als een replica wordt verwijderd en een andere replica wordt gemaakt op hetzelfde knooppunt voor dezelfde partitie, krijgt deze een andere waarde voor de id. Soms wordt de id van een staatloze service-instantie ook wel een replica-id genoemd.
CurrentReplicatorOperation
Type: tekenreeks (opsomming)
Vereist: Nee
Hiermee geeft u de bewerking die momenteel wordt uitgevoerd door de replicator.
Mogelijke waarden zijn:
-
Invalid
- Standaardwaarde als de replicator nog niet gereed is. -
None
- Replicator voert geen bewerking uit vanuit het perspectief van Service Fabric. -
Open
- Replicator wordt geopend. -
ChangeRole
- Replicator is bezig met het wijzigen van de rol. -
UpdateEpoch
- Vanwege een wijziging in de replicaset wordt de replicator bijgewerkt met het epoch. -
Close
- Replicator wordt gesloten. -
Abort
- Replicator wordt afgebroken. -
OnDataLoss
- Replicator verwerkt de voorwaarde voor gegevensverlies, waarbij de gebruikersservice mogelijk de status van een externe bron herstelt. -
WaitForCatchup
- Replicator wacht totdat een quorum van replica's de meest recente status heeft bereikt. -
Build
- Replicator is bezig met het bouwen van een of meer replica's.
ReadStatus
Type: tekenreeks (opsomming)
Vereist: Nee
Hiermee geeft u de toegangsstatus van de partitie.
Mogelijke waarden zijn:
-
Invalid
- Geeft aan dat de toegangsstatus van de lees- of schrijfbewerking ongeldig is. Deze waarde wordt niet geretourneerd naar de aanroeper. -
Granted
- Geeft aan dat de lees- of schrijfbewerking toegang is verleend en de bewerking is toegestaan. -
ReconfigurationPending
- Geeft aan dat de client het later opnieuw moet proberen, omdat er een herconfiguratie wordt uitgevoerd. -
NotPrimary
- Geeft aan dat deze clientaanvraag is ontvangen door een replica die geen primaire replica is. -
NoWriteQuorum
- Geeft aan dat er geen schrijfquorum beschikbaar is en dat er daarom geen schrijfbewerking kan worden geaccepteerd.
WriteStatus
Type: tekenreeks (opsomming)
Vereist: Nee
Hiermee geeft u de toegangsstatus van de partitie.
Mogelijke waarden zijn:
-
Invalid
- Geeft aan dat de toegangsstatus van de lees- of schrijfbewerking ongeldig is. Deze waarde wordt niet geretourneerd naar de aanroeper. -
Granted
- Geeft aan dat de lees- of schrijfbewerking toegang is verleend en de bewerking is toegestaan. -
ReconfigurationPending
- Geeft aan dat de client het later opnieuw moet proberen, omdat er een herconfiguratie wordt uitgevoerd. -
NotPrimary
- Geeft aan dat deze clientaanvraag is ontvangen door een replica die geen primaire replica is. -
NoWriteQuorum
- Geeft aan dat er geen schrijfquorum beschikbaar is en dat er daarom geen schrijfbewerking kan worden geaccepteerd.
ReplicatorStatus
Type: ReplicatorStatus
Vereist: Nee
Vertegenwoordigt een basisklasse voor de status van de primaire of secundaire replicator.
Bevat informatie over de Service Fabric-replicator, zoals het gebruik van de replicatie-/kopieerwachtrij, de tijdstempel van de laatste ontvangstbevestiging, enzovoort.
ReplicaStatus
Type: KeyValueStoreReplicaStatus
Vereist: Nee
Gerelateerde informatie over sleutelwaardeopslag voor de replica.
DeployedServiceReplicaQueryResult
Type: DeployedStatefulServiceReplicaInfo
Vereist: Nee
Informatie over een stateful servicereplica die is geïmplementeerd op een knooppunt.